Hadleigh Lighting and Electrical business to close

By Derek Davis

23rd Mar 2022 | Local News

The lights are permanently going out on a family-run Hadleigh electrical company at the end of next week.

Hadleigh Lighting & Electrical Ltd in Semer Court, Crockatt Road, which has been in the Sellen family for more than 30 years. is closing after current owners Keith and Linda Sellen who have run it for the past 15 years, decided to retire.

While a new owner has been found for the property, Mr Sellen, aged 57, confirmed the business was shutting down and no one else would be taking over.

A closing down sale is in progress at the shop, which sells interior and exterior lighting and lamps.

Mr Sellen declined to comment further.
